I would have to slightly disagree. While a high time FO won't be denied an interview(depending on focus) the current focus in on a more long term employee. Jetblue does not hope to keep you for a career, however, they would like you to stay long enough to absorb your training costs. The company is quite comfortable with turnover provided its not within the 1-3 year pilot demographic.
